With the ethos of strengthening the community resilience through peer support and joint learning, Govanhill Baths Community Trust has been actively engaging with the Somali Association in Glasgow, the Friends of Romano Lav and the local Irish community to strengthen their organisations during the pandemic.

We have secured Wellbeing funding which is being used by the organisations towards hiring and training community workers, drivers and activity facilitators, as well as covering the costs for volunteer expenses, the distribution of food and Mother and Toddler packs. Their community workers are developing, together with our Learning and Outreach officer, fun and educational activity packs that the whole family can enjoy. Irish residents have now access to a befriending and signposting program.
